Laboratory Safety: Best Practices
To ensure a safe research setting , comprehensive security protocols need to be implemented. These cover sufficient personal protective equipment , such as hand coverings , eyewear, and lab coats . In addition, detailed documentation of experiments and reagent manipulation is essential . Scheduled safety instruction for all employees is necessary , and prompt notification of occurrences is paramount to stopping future harm . Finally , maintaining a clean and well-ventilated workspace is fundamental for complete laboratory security .

Testing Analysis: Techniques and Applications
Lab analysis employs a selection of complex techniques to establish the composition and qualities of materials. Common methods include spectroscopy for identifying chemical patterns, chromatography for isolating components, and quantitative measurement for precise assessment of amounts. These analytical instruments find wide-ranging applications in sectors such as medicine, ecological science, dietary security, and substance engineering. The results from testing assessment are essential for knowledgeable judgments and improving research awareness.
